The 2024 US Chess Championships concluded with Fabiano Caruana and Carissa Yip emerging as outright winners in their respective sections. Caruana secured his fourth national title by defeating Sam Shankland in the final round, finishing 1½ points ahead of his closest rivals. Meanwhile, Yip had already clinched her third US Women’s Championship with a round to spare, despite back-to-back losses in rounds 9 and 10.
